How to Calibrate Your Joy-Cons?

Calibrating your Joy-Cons can help resolve drifting issues. Here’s a step-by-step guide to do it:

System Settings: Go to the System Settings on your Nintendo Switch.

Controllers and Sensors: Click on Controllers and Sensors and then select Calibrate Control Sticks.

Tilt the Stick: Tilt the left control stick in all directions until it reaches the end of its range. You may need to press the ‘X’ button to exit the calibration process and test the stick again.
